It contains code that will perform rainflow cycle counting. Software, with focus on dynamics, fatigue and load development. Cycle counting using rainflow algorithm for fatigue analysis. The rainflowcounting algorithm also known as the rainflow counting method is used in the analysis of fatigue data in order to reduce a spectrum of varying stress into an equivalent set of simple stress reversals. The most accurate fatigue life estimates are obtained using an analysis based on the strain at the most highly stressedstrained location. Nice ct scans of 3d aluminum printed fatigue test specimens.
In frequency domain analysis, power spectral density function estimates of normal. Combined with dewesoft x it represents a powerful allinone fatigue analysis solution allowing both acquisition and analysis of the fatigue data everything in a single software. Rainflow counting is a method to determine the number of fatigue cycles present in a loadtime history. Downing and socie created one of the more widely referenced and utilized rainflow cycle counting algorithms in 1982, which was included as one of many cycle counting algorithms in astm e 104985 standard practices for cycle counting in fatigue analysis. Apr 03, 2020 fatiguetoolbox just got a major overhaul. Fatigue essentials provides a user friendly tool for conducting stresslife analysis either using classical stress. With enough repeated cycles, a part will weaken and eventually fail. There is a variety of such cycle counting methods in use, but for use in variable amplitude fatigue analysis the socalled rainflow counting method has become the prevailing method. Fatigue failure involves complex phenomena and mechanism, and the. Rainflow algorithms are one of the best counting methods used in fatigue and failure analysis 17. The efatigue website gives you easy access to modern fatigue analysis tools and technology from any web browser everything you need for computing the fatigue lives of metallic machine components and structures, including fatigue calculators, material databases, and stress concentration factors.
Rainflow cycle counting in fatigue analysis revision a by tom irvine email. Different rainflow counting standards, such as astm, din and afnor, differ with respect to the treatment of the residuals. For rainflow analysis when the mean calculation method is specified as per halfcycle means. Create a project open source software business software. These steps are fully documented in standards such as astm e1049 standard practices for cycle counting in fatigue analysis 1. It is located under strain, stress fatigue analysis. Rainflow counts for fatigue analysis matlab rainflow. Fatigue essentials provides a user friendly tool for conducting stresslife analysis either using fatigue essentials applied cax nx software, training and support.
The efatigue website gives you easy access to modern fatigue analysis tools and technology from any web browser everything you need for computing the fatigue lives of. The output is the raw rainflow results, which consists of half cycles and full cycles. In addition to the fatlab project, it now contains several other fatigue resources such as publications and fatigue data. In order to be as general as possible, the fatigue analysis module supports both residual and nonresidual mode. The rainflow counting algorithm is used in the analysis of fatigue data in order to reduce a spectrum of varying stress into an equivalent set of simple stress reversals. Contents page introduction 1 cyclecountingmethods 2 rainflowcyclecountingmethod 2 meancrossingrangetechnique 8 summary 10 references 11 appendix 1computerprogramlistfor rainflowcyclecountingmethod 12. Rainflow counting method rainflow counting consists of four main steps. Sfat is a fatigue life analysis software for steel structures, components, as well as welded and bolted connections in bridges, cranes, offshore platforms, offshore wind structures, and other structures subjected to cyclic loading.
The method successively extracts the smaller interruption cycles from a sequence. In the future, the site will be updated more regularly and with more broad fatigue topics. Rainflow counting algorithm 4pointmethod, c99 compliant. Mathworks is the leading developer of mathematical computing software. The output is the range and mean of each cycle, as shown in the image on the right. The output is the range and mean of each cycle, as. In 1986, the first astm rainflow counting standard, e1049, was published. Fatigue analysis software analyzing structural fatigue.
Rainflow counting 4 is an essential part of these procedures. Jul 23, 20 rainflow count method posted on july 23, 20 by aerospace engineering the rainflow rainflow counting method is used in the analysis of fatigue in order to reduce a spectrum of varying stress into a set of simple stress reversals. The rainflowcounting method is used in the analysis of fatigue data in order to reduce a spectrum of varying stress into a set of simple stress reversals 15. Downloads tl anderson consulting fracture mechanics. The rainflow procedure is a cyclecounting method that makes it possible to store service measurements in a form suitable for fatigue analysis of structures. The starting point has been a given structure and a known. Sign up rainflow cycle counting in fatigue analysis the. Aug 29, 2019 by reducing the time data size, the calculation speed for a durability fatigue analysis is decreased, and the amount of computer storage required is lowered. Astm e1049852017, standard practices for cycle counting in fatigue analysis. Initially, rainflow turns the load history into a sequence of reversals. Jul 30, 20 mod04 lec03 fatigue loading and fatigue analysis nptelhrd. Jrain free rainflow counting software fatigue spectrum rainflow analysis the load histories applied to components such as an aircraft wing, a car suspension or an oil rig structure are irregular in nature, whereas fatigue coupon test data are usually obtained from constant amplitude loading.
A new online, realtime rainflow counting algorithm. A fatigue cycle is the loading and unloading of a part as shown in figure 1. Spreadsheet that performs a constantamplitude fatigue crack growth analysis with numerical integration. The most accurate fatigue life estimates are obtained using an analysis. Fatigarfc is a software tool for rainflow counting. Rainflow counting estimates the number of load change cycles as a function of. By reducing the time data size, the calculation speed for a durability fatigue analysis is decreased, and the amount of computer storage required is lowered. Fatigue analysis studies how damage accumulates in an object subjected to cyclical changes in stress. The method successively extracts the smaller interruption cycles from a sequence, which models the material memory effect seen with stressstrain hysterisis cycles. Sep 15, 2015 this video explains graphically the principle behind the rainflow counting method. The rainflow algorithm code has been prepared according to the astm standard standard practices for cycle counting in fatigue analysis and optimized considering the calculation time.
Make the amplitudes of the first and last data points the same by appending a data point if necessary. The rainflow counting method is used in the analysis of fatigue data in order to reduce a spectrum of varying stress into a set of simple stress reversals 15. Downing and socie created one of the more widely referenced and utilized rainflow cyclecounting algorithms in 1982, which was. Rainflow cycle counting part 23algorithm development duration. It is used for stochastic, spectral based on deterministic analysis, full deterministic or. A benchmark model of the rainflow counting algorithm compares results between astm and comsol fatigue module using a flat tensile test specimen. Fatpack is a package for fatigue analysis of data series with python and numpy. Rainflow cycle counting in time domain is examined by taking the time history of load as an input. The rainflow counting algorithm also known as the rainflow counting method is used in the analysis of fatigue data in order to reduce a spectrum of varying stress into a set of simple stress reversals. The framework software module is an interactive postprocessor for fatigue and earthquake analysis of frame models.
Take your stresstime history data at a vertex into software that does the rainflow counting into bins, computes the fatigue damage on each bin and does the summation of total. Its importance is that it allows the application of miners rule in order to assess the fatigue life of a structure subject to complex loading. There have been many approaches to the rainflow algorithm, some proposing modifications. This implementation uses the 4point algorithm mentioned in 2. Scilab based macro for rainflow method of cycle counting used for fatigue analysis. Pdf modified rainflow counting algorithm for fatigue life. Fatigue essentials applied cax nx software, training and. Please also watch the followup video that demonstrates how the stress spectrum is populated. Pdf modified rainflow counting algorithm for fatigue. Enduricas fatigue solver shows how your design will endure in. An extension is made for the cumulative damage calculation following the palmgrenminer model and results are compared with analytical expressions. Rainflow counting estimates the number of load change cycles as a function of cycle amplitude.
Rainflow counting an overview sciencedirect topics. The starting point has been a given structure and a known loading from which we are able to construct a relevant stress history as basis for the fatigue design. Rainflow counting algorithm file exchange matlab central. Fatigue essentials is a desktop application used to efficiently conduct structural fatigue analysis. Mod04 lec03 fatigue loading and fatigue analysis youtube. Rainflow counting is a process to obtain equivalent constant amplitude cycles. It is used for stochastic, spectral based on deterministic analysis, full deterministic or time domain rainflow counting fatigue of beams. Fem postprocessor for fatigue analysis pfat is a software that postprocesses results from fem analyses in order to compute fatigue damage in structures. To use data from loadtime histories in fatigue analysis, cycles need to be extracted from that history.
Stress range histories and rain flow counting introduction in the previous sections we have considered most of the elements of a fatigue design. The rainflow method allows the application of miners rule in order. Reversals are the local minima and maxima where the load changes sign. Enduricas fatigue simulation software gives you the tools you need to analyze fatigue to get durability right, before you build and break. Combined with dewesoft x it represents a powerful allinone fatigue analysis solution allowing both acquisition and analysis of the fatigue data everything in a single software package. Fatigarfc rainflow counting tool fatec engineering. Stoflo is a free software application within microsoft excel. Fatigue essentials applied cax nx software, training. Fatigue analysis, damage calculation, rainflow counting. The load histories applied to components such as an aircraft wing, a car suspension or an oil rig structure are irregular in. Fatigue analysis module supports a wide range of fatigue analysis features and utils. Enduricas fatigue solver shows how your design will endure in specific application scenarios. The rainflow rainflow counting method is used in the analysis of fatigue in order to reduce a spectrum of varying stress into a set of simple stress reversals.
Rainflow cycle counting for random vibration fatigue analysis. Aug 20, 2019 rainflow counting algorithm 4pointmethod, c99 compliant. Sign up rainflow cycle counting in fatigue analysis the rainflow method is a method for counting fatigue cycles from a time history. The number of cycles necessary to break the object depends on the cycle amplitude. The fatigue analysis of the test specimen is carried out in both time and frequency domains.